Myrmidons are the hands. Each executes a delegated task and reports back concisely — responses to Titan are enforced to a single paragraph, 1000 words max by default (configurable via `maxResponseWords`), keeping Titan's context lean. Every Myrmidon declares a `modelType` that shapes how Titan routes work to it:
